We are seeking a skilled SAP Data Quality Rules Developer to join our dynamic team. This role is central to enhancing the quality and governance of enterprise data within the SAP S/4HANA system. Leveraging your expertise in SQL and ideally your experience with Syniti Advanced Data Migration and Management (ADMM) software, you will work with Functional Data Leads to design and implement data quality rules to improve the reliability and accuracy of our master data. This position offers the opportunity to work on innovative projects, collaborate with cross-functional teams, and contribute to shaping the organization's data quality strategy.
What you will be responsible for:
Develop, implement, and manage data quality rules using Syniti ADMM software to enhance SAP S/4HANA master data quality.
Analyze and understand SAP tables and data structures to design effective data quality solutions.
Write and optimize SQL queries to support data quality analysis and rule execution.
Collaborate with business stakeholders to understand data quality requirements and deliver tailored solutions.
Work with Functional Data Leads to perform data profiling, analysis, and reporting to identify and address data quality issues.
Monitor and refine data quality processes to ensure continuous improvement.
Document technical specifications, processes, and solutions for internal use and training.
Stay updated on emerging data quality tools, methodologies, and SAP technologies.
About you:
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or a related field.
3+ years of experience in SAP data management or data quality development.
Proficiency in SQL, with a proven track record of writing efficient and complex queries.
Strong understanding of SAP table structures and relationships.
Familiarity with SAP ECC and S/4HANA tables and data structures.
Knowledge of data quality principles, data governance, and related best practices.
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
Excellent communication and stakeholder engagement abilities.
Experience with Syniti ADMM software or equivalent data migration/data quality tools would be an advantage.
Certification in SAP S/4HANA, SAP ECC or related data management tools would be an advantage.
